Trailer License Plate Mount Bracket, Heavy-Duty Zinc-Plated Steel

A heavy-duty license plate bracket for use with stud-mount license plate lights. With zinc-plated all-steel construction, this bracket is extremely durable.

  • Polished metal license plate bracket
  • Made of heavy-duty zinc-plated steel
  • Used with stud-mount license lights and combination stop, tail, and license lights

Manufacturer Cross Reference
Bracket will work as an exact replacement for:
Uni Bond # LH1000Z
Wesbar # 3203
Peterson # B428-09
Bargman # 30-72-100

Manufacturer Specifications

Zinc plated steel license plate bracket, designed for durability. For use with stud-mount license lights.

Video Transcript for Optronics Trailer License Plate Mount Bracket Installation

Today we're going to show you Optronics Trailer License Plate Mount Bracket, part number LP15SB. First off, with our bracket this is an all-metal construction. In its typical application, this license bracket is designed to sit behind the bracket that holds your taillight in place. In this case, we're on the driver's side or left-hand side. Typically they will line up with the studs on the lights. You can mount this either way you'd like, but typically you want this underneath so it sticks underneath the light on the bottom for the license plate. Let's go ahead and install it. Pretty simply.

Let's go ahead and remove these two nuts. Most of the time it's going to be a 7/16. In certain situations, it won't fit like this, so you can flip it around and install it that way as well. Of course, we realize that not as much light will go onto your license plate, but it will still work just fine. Then you can go ahead and install your license plate; 1/4" hardware will work just fine for that.

This hardware does not come with it as well. Since it is recessed inaudible 00:01:14 back, let's go ahead and turn off the lights and try it out and see how the trailer light illuminates the license plate. Even though it's recessed, it's still doing its job. That will finish it for a Optronics Trailer License Plate Mount Bracket, part number LP15SB. .

  • Recommendation for a License Plate Bracket for a Small Cargo Trailer
    I believe I have just the right license plate bracket for you. Take a look at the Trailer License Plate Mount Bracket, # LP15SB. It is just a little over 8 inches long at 8-7/16 inches. It is 4 inches tall. The center to center distance between the center slotted holes is 2-1/4 inches but can be 2-3/4 inches apart at the outside edges. The top most set of holes are 2 inches apart on center. I have included a picture showing the dimensions for you.

  • Dimensions of the Optronics # LP15SB
    The Trailer License Plate Mount Bracket, Heavy Duty Zinc Steel # LP15SB is 1/16 inch thick. That makes it 16 gauge sheet metal. I've attached a photo with other dimensions that will most likely be helpful as well.

  • Metal License Plate Holder and Bracket for a 2012 Karavan Boat Trailer
    Metal license plate bracket # LP15SB would be a good option. The top most mounting holes are 2 inches apart on center. I included a picture showing the dimensions. We also have steel cover # LP20SB. I have included a picture of its dimensions as well. Being steel, it would not be as corrosion resistant as # LP15SB. Aluminum bracket # CE26053A is another excellent corrosion resistant option. Its mounting holes are 1-1/2 inches part on center.
